ALL residents in the borough of Ealing are to have on-street vehicle charging points within a ten-minute walk, Ealing Council have stated.

This comes as the Council announced their aim to have 300 electric vehicle charging points by the end of the year.

There are currently 176 electric charge points in the borough and the council is installing another 150 with suppliers Source London and Siemens Ubitricty.

The council hopes this will help more people switch to electric vehicles, which they say are more cost-effective and environmentally-friendly.

This is part of the council's wider climate strategy, which aims to cut carbon emissions in the borough and achieve 'net zero' by 2030.

Councillor Deirdre Costigan, deputy leader and cabinet member for climate action, said: "We are committed to tackling climate change and improving local air quality."By putting in place electric vehicle charging points we are supporting residents to take up the use of electric vehicles.

"It is all part of our ambitious commitment to active improve the way we travel, which includes cycle routes, school streets, 24-hour bus lanes and two permanent low traffic neighbourhoods to make active making travel more healthy, accessible and easy for all of us."

In a council Youtube video she added there was a very high demand for the charging points and unfortunately that it is "not possible to install them in every location due to physical and safety considerations".
